Blockchain: por que um sistema sem confiança é o sistema mais confiável

Compreendendo a tecnologia

O mundo em que vivemos está equipado com muitas tecnologias diferentes e temos uma compreensão clara das funcionalidades básicas dessas tecnologias. No entanto, uma porcentagem considerável de usuários não mostra interesse em descobrir mais informações sobre a tecnologia em jogo.

Todos nós sabemos enviar e-mails. Quando enviamos um e-mail, esperamos que ele chegue ao destinatário, a menos que o processo de transferência de dados falhe. Em tal situação, veríamos a opção “Tentar novamente”. Assim que recebermos esta mensagem, simplesmente vamos em frente e clicamos naquele botão. Infelizmente, a maioria de nós não tem qualquer compreensão sobre os aspectos técnicos e protocolos associados a um e-mail.

Como isso se aplica ao Blockchain?

O cenário mencionado acima também se aplica ao Blockchain. Quando pensamos em Blockchain, sabemos que os dados são transparentes, imutáveis ​​e o sistema é um tanto difícil de ser hackeado. Infelizmente, a maioria de nós não sabe por que um Blockchain é tão seguro. Para descobrir isso, devemos descobrir alguns dos recursos básicos associados à tecnologia Blockchain, que podem aumentar sua segurança ao armazenar suas informações.

Os recursos de segurança do Blockchains

O número de ataques cibernéticos está aumentando diariamente. Portanto, estamos sempre preocupados com nossos dados armazenados digitalmente. A característica mais proeminente de um Blockchain é que ele é um sistema completamente sem confiança. Em outras palavras, as permissões concedidas para gravar e ler dados em um Blockchain foram distribuídas igualmente entre todos os usuários que estão conectados à rede. No entanto, é importante ter em mente que nenhum usuário recebeu privilégios especiais para tomar decisões.

Antes da introdução do Blockchain, não era possível compartilhar informações uns com os outros em tempo real sem confiança. Portanto, podemos afirmar que a introdução da tecnologia Blockchain forneceu uma solução ideal para o problema do General Bizantino. Este é o nome de um problema com as desvantagens dos sistemas de consenso distribuídos. Presume-se que o general comandando várias unidades tem a capacidade de lançar um ataque a uma cidade específica. Se as unidades do General atacam ao mesmo tempo, o ataque terminará em vitória. Se qualquer uma das unidades associadas recuar ou apresentar defeitos, todo o ataque terminaria em falha.

Nesta situação, uma mensagem dada pelo General deve ser entregue a todas as unidades associadas. No entanto, existe a possibilidade de um comandante traidor mudar a mensagem sem o consentimento do General. Os comandantes que receberem esta mensagem alterada acreditariam que é o comando fornecido pelo General, embora o comandante traidor tenha feito algumas alterações no conteúdo do mesmo. Isso pode levar a um ataque fracassado. A má coordenação que existe entre as diferentes unidades pode contribuir para esta falha no ataque.

Como a tecnologia Blockchain superou esse problema?

A tecnologia Blockchain foi capaz de superar esse problema de maneira bem-sucedida. Para contornar o problema, eles introduziram um conceito totalmente novo, que foi batizado de Prova de Trabalho. Com o conceito de Prova de Trabalho, tornou-se imprescindível que todos os remetentes da mensagem anexassem um histórico de mensagens anteriores.

O objetivo principal de gastar algum tempo era ter certeza de que o remetente realmente dedicou algum tempo e esforço para escrever a mensagem. Este é um parâmetro que está sendo usado para descobrir dados incorretos ou maliciosos. Se você pegar o “problema do General Bizantino” por exemplo, todos os comandantes precisarão escrever de 1 a 500 números antes de confirmar e enviar a mensagem ao comandante seguinte. Como você pode ver, demoraria algum tempo para escrever os números. No entanto, o processo de verificação seria fácil e rápido. Por meio desse mecanismo simples, o Blockchain foi capaz de superar o problema complexo.

Outros benefícios da natureza descentralizada de Blockchains

Como os Blockchains são completamente descentralizados, o governo não tem a capacidade de controlá-los. Se um governo interferir, alguns dos sites e domínios serão encerrados. Portanto, todos os sites e domínios terão a necessidade de funcionar de acordo com as regras e regulamentos específicos que são implementados pelo governo. Isso é algo que não pode ser alcançado no mundo prático. O melhor exemplo que você pode dar é o motor de busca de torrent, que tinha o domínio Torrentz.eu. Não há possibilidade de desligar esse mecanismo de torrent, mesmo que ele não esteja funcionando de acordo com as regras e regulamentos específicos implementados pelo governo. Portanto, os motores de busca de torrent são muito semelhantes a um sistema descentralizado.

Por outro lado, os dados armazenados dentro de um Blockchain são criptograficamente protegidos. Além disso, uma criptografia de chave pública e privada está sendo usada para garantir que os dados sejam transferidos apenas para as pessoas que realmente precisam usá-los. Isso pode garantir a privacidade na rede de maneira eficaz.

Conclusão

Todos os recursos de segurança associados a um Blockchain o tornam um protocolo ideal para indivíduos que desejam armazenar suas informações em uma mídia de armazenamento digital, sem expô-los a nenhuma das ameaças de segurança potenciais que podem ser encontradas online.